As nouns, responsibility is a hyponym of orbit; that is, responsibility is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than orbit:
  • orbit: a particular environment or walk of life
  • responsibility: the proper sphere or extent of your activities
Other hyponyms of orbit include distaff, front, kingdom, land, realm, lap, political arena, political sphere, preserve, province.
